Pierre-Emerick Emiliano François Aubameyang ONM is a French-born Gabonese professional footballer who plays as a striker for Premier League club Arsenal and captains the Gabon national team.
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ang is renowned for his pace, finishing, and off-ball movement.
Pierre-Emerick began his senior club career playing for Italian club AC Milan, but never appeared for the club as he went on a series of loan spells in France.
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ang then moved to Saint-Étienne in 2011, where he won a Coupe de la Ligue title and joined Borussia Dortmund in 2013.

In Germany,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ang finished as the league’s top goalscorer in the 2016–17 season and won a DFB-Pokal.
In 2018,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ang was the subject of a then-club record association football transfer when signed for Arsenal in a transfer worth £56 million (€60 million), making him the most expensive Gabonese player of all time.

In 2016, Aubameyang was named African Footballer of the Year; the first Gabonese and second European-born player to win the award.
Meet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ang’s son Curtys Aubameyang
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ang is married to Alysha Behague and they have two sons, Curtys and Pierre.
Curtys Aubameyang was born in August 2011.
